janetz Posted April 20, 2006 #3 Share Posted April 20, 2006 Ask your room steward as soon as you board to remove everything from the refrigerator, and they will. Always go to the pursor's desk mid sailing and get a print out of your charges so you can check them. Always keep your charge slips too. :o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

lindalo5032 Posted April 20, 2006 #5 Share Posted April 20, 2006 On the Spirit last summer we asked the Steward to remove the Carnival stuff from our refrigerator. He said he wasn't allowed to do that--his supervisor wouldn't let him. I was disappointed because I had read that on some ships they will do this for you. We had our own cokes and water we wanted to put in the fridge and didn't want them to get mixed in with the ship's beverages. We ended up putting the ship's stock in the cabinets beside the fridge.
